Output f404db0cadbbcae8ec9a161bb0b986af1d79ca3a28d4d6bbf3bc27db8d928516:2

value
2999361
script pubkey
OP_0 OP_PUSHBYTES_20 21ae9ed90081f33405dc035b120dc416b99a0dbd
address
bc1qyxhfakgqs8engpwuqdd3yrwyz6ue5rdaxphnp4
transaction
f404db0cadbbcae8ec9a161bb0b986af1d79ca3a28d4d6bbf3bc27db8d928516
confirmations
348200
spent
true